Packing Operator Responsibilities:
- Operate and monitor packaging machinery to ensure product quality.

- Enter work orders and item codes, weigh and label blocks.
- Box cheese and perform quality control checks.
- Palletize and move finished products to staging areas.
- Close work orders and record shipment information.
- Perform setup, calibration, and minor maintenance on equipment.
- Sanitize equipment and packaging areas per procedures.

Packing Operator Requirements:

-High school degree or equivalent (GED), preferred.
-Experience in a manufacturing setting, preferably food manufacturing.
-Lift 20-30lbs repetitively, flipping and lifting product above shoulder height and from waist down to floor level pallets
-Strong operation control and monitoring skills.
-Basic math skills for weight measurement and counts.
-Ability to read and comprehend work-related documents and instructions.
-Basic computer skills, including familiarity with Microsoft Office.
-Forklift certified (training and certification provided internally).
-Must be quality focused and able to follow GMP requirements and food safety requirements
